The traditional growth theory usually considers only the accumulation of conventional inputs of labor and capital as the primary variables responsible for the growth. It has been proven to be insufficient for explaining the complexity of modern economic growth. This thesis aims to study a two-region economic growth model proposed by Zhang (2005). This model explains the dynamics of economic system based on capital and knowledge accumulation. It also considers relationships between regional growth and regional trade patterns. Each region's production is similar to the standard one-sector growth model. Knowledge accumulation is assumed to be accomplished through learning by doing. Unfortunately, in obtaining the equilibrium solution of the model Zhang made some mistakes. Therefore, this thesis offers some corrections. The analysis done in this thesis includes obtaining equilibrium of the economic system and its feasibility conditions. Some results of simulation study show that knowledge improvement is more effective to increase equilibrium value of economic growth compared to improvement in investment or amenity level.

AbstractBackground: The study models a dynamic interaction among economic growth, structural change, knowledge accumulation, international trade and tourist flows. Objective: The purpose of this study is to introduce endogenous knowledge into a multi-country growth model with trade and tourism proposed by Zhang. The study models a dynamic interaction among economic growth, structural change, knowledge accumulation, international trade and tourist flows. Methods/Approach: The model is based on Arrow’s learning by doing, the Solow one-sector growth model, the Oniki-Uzawa neoclassical trade model, and the Uzawa two-sector growth model. We first build the multi-country neoclassical growth model of endogenous knowledge with international tourism. Then we show that we can follow the motion of the J - country world economy with J + 1 differential equations. Results: We simulate the motion of the three-country global economy. We carry out a comparative dynamic analysis by simulation with regard to the knowledge utilization efficiency, the efficiency of learning by doing, the propensity to save, the propensity to tour other countries, and the population. Conclusions: The global economy has a unique equilibrium.

This paper proposes a one-sector multigroup growth model with endogenous labor supply in discrete time. Proposing an alternative approach to behavior of households, we examine the dynamics of wealth and income distribution in a competitive economy with capital accumulation as the main engine of economic growth. We show how human capital levels, preferences, and labor force of heterogeneous households determine the national economic growth, wealth, and income distribution and time allocation of the groups. By simulation we demonstrate, for instance, that in the three-group economy when the rich group's human capital is improved, all the groups will economically benefit, and the leisure times of all the groups are reduced but when any other group's human capital is improved, the group will economically benefit, the other two groups economically lose, and the leisure times of all the groups are increased.
